## Env Vars: Querygrove N+1 Fix

Quick recap for the weekly sync: the Querygrove GraphQL layer was hammering the orders table with an N+1 pattern — one query per line item, ouch. Priya's batching loader fix landed last Tuesday and p95 latency dropped by about 60%. The loader now caches against Fenwick's shared Redis tier, which means every environment needs the batching flag plus the cache credential wired up. For local testing, set the loader's cache secret in your env file like so:

sealed setting: LEDGER_TOKEN20=2c35cb354eeee67036d2

Ticket: Seat-map renderer rewrite for the Gildenhall Theatre client. Quick context for the sync: the current canvas renderer falls over on the 1,400-seat balcony layout — pan gets janky and seat hover states lag by a good half second. The proposal is to move to a tiled SVG approach with viewport culling, which benchmarked about 4x faster in the spike. We'd like to merge before the Gildenhall season launch. This needs a sign-off from the person named below.

account owner for fajep-yagef: Kasix Eliiel

Handover — Vexler partner SFTP drop

Ownership moves to you today. Drop runs hourly from Vexler's end into the intake bucket via the relay host. Watch for zero-byte files; their exporter flakes on Mondays. Creds live in the ops vault, path noted in the runbook. Vault auto-seals after 48h idle. Support escalations go to the on-call rotation, not me. If the vault is sealed when you need it, unseal with the recovery passphrase below.

recovery phrase for tadug-fafof: zorwyn-kasion

**Checklist item 7 — contrast audit signing key.** Before we wrap the ceremony, double-check that the Tintfold audit key pair was generated on the air-gapped laptop and that the public half made it into the Wexlow registry. The private half gets sealed in the envelope — no photos, obviously. Once sealed, the witness signs the log. To unseal later for re-audit, use the recovery passphrase below.

unlock words, yawig-kagef: gordor-holvan-ulaael-pramir-ulaiel-tamdor